Integration specialist appointed transactions chief at KPMG

John Kelly promoted to head of transaction services

John Kelly has been appointed head of KPMG’s transaction services business.

Kelly, an integration specialist, started as a consultant at the firm and
moved into transaction services in 2002.

“After the dramatic fall in M&A activity in the last 18 months, we are
starting to see the first tentative signs of cautious optimism. If engaging
transactions advisers is a gauge of life, our own pipeline suggests the M&A
market may be coming out of its coma,” said Kelly.
